To go into further detail, this is what happened with the audio:


I’m shooting this film with a Sony ZV-E10. Using the SIRUI Night Walker 24mm S35 Manual Focus Cine Lens. I ordered these wireless microphones (Hollyland Lark A1 Wireless Microphone) because it was listed as compatible with my camera at the time of purchase. Best believe I left a review once I realized it wasn’t compatible at all so now the description on Amazon now says it’s only compatible for iPhone 15 and up. Yeah iight. Anyway, since filming began in less than a day, my homeboy GG who’s the lead actor has a newer iPhone so we used his phone to record audio with the mics. Two things that fucked us up that we didn’t know or paid attention to at the time:


  1. I had a Rode microphone plugged into the camera and that didn’t get any audio. On day one, we wore wired headphones so we can watch and listen to the playback after every other take. We didn’t do this on day two. As the director, I’ll take full responsibility and accountability for this mistake. Won’t happen again.


  1. Halfway into filming on day two, the wireless microphones died. We didn’t know it died to the point it wasn’t recording because the light on the mics were green and towards the end as we were wrapping up, it went red. But the app we were recording audio was still rolling but it didn’t save for whatever reason. So I only have audio from half of the day.
